>> On Thu, Mar 05, 2009 at 12:47:24PM -0500, Mike Leferman wrote:
>> > I'm using Ubuntu 8.10, and /usr/local/lib is in my ld.so.conf.  Does
>> > ldconfig just update ld.so.conf? My program finds libusrp2 in the
>> > /usr/local/lib folder, so it should be able to find libgruel (which I'm
>> > guessing is the problem?)  Do I have to have my program link libgruel as
>> > well?  Is this failing because I don't use usrp2.lo when i link the
>> library?
>> >  Thanks for the help!
>> > - Mike
>>
>> Try using pkg-config to get the usrp2 dependencies:
>>
>>  $ pkg-config usrp2 --cflags
>>  -DOMNITHREAD_POSIX=1 -pthread -I/usr/local/include
>> -I/usr/local/include/gnuradio
>>
>>  $ pkg-config usrp2 --libs
>>  -L/usr/local/lib -lusrp2 -lgromnithread -lgruel
